How is the dimensional formula of power used in solving problems?

I understand the dimensional formula of power is [ML^2T^-3], but how is this used in actual problem-solving?

The dimensional formula of power, [ML2T-3], is very useful in solving various physics problems, especially in checking the consistency of equations and converting units. Here are a couple of ways it can be used:

  1. Checking Dimensional Consistency: When you derive or manipulate equations, you can use dimensional analysis to check if both sides of the equation have the same dimensions. For example, if you are given an equation involving power, you can ensure that the dimensional formula on both sides matches [ML2T-3].
  2. Unit Conversion: The dimensional formula helps in converting one set of units to another. For example, if you need to convert power from watts to another unit, knowing that 1 watt = 1 joule/second and using the dimensional formula, you can easily perform the conversion.

Understanding and utilizing dimensional formulas like that of power can greatly simplify your problem-solving process in physics.
